Flat 13, Maytrees, 100 Fishponds Road, Eastville, Bristol, BS5 6SB is a leasehold flat built between 2003-2006. The property offers approximately 678 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£189,347 , which equates to approximately £279 per square foot. It was last sold on 7 Sep 2021 for £169,995. Since then, the value has increased by £19,352, representing a 11.4% increase, or approximately 2.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£189,347 is:

  • 41.7% lower than the average property price on Fishponds Road
  • 2.4% higher than the average in the BS5 6SB postcode area
  • and 57.9% lower than the average price for Bristol as a whole

Flat 13, Maytrees, 100 Fishponds Road, Eastville, Bristol, City Of Bristol, BS5 6SB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 27 Feb 2020.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 Feb 2010.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 3.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the system remained as electric immersion, off-peak.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 90%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
